American Community Survey Paints Mentor by the Numbers
The annual Census Bureau poll shows up-to-date demographic information
Home values may be dropping around the country, but not in Mentor. According to recent data from the U.S. Census Bureau, median home values here have increased since 2000. That year, median home value was $147,400. Now, the value is $174,000. That information comes from the 2005-2009 American Community Survey, an annual poll that the helps describe how Americans live. The most recent estimates were released in December. The data is used to guide local policies, and determine how $400 billion in state and federal funds are allocated, according to the Census Bureau.
